Navigating the diverse market of camera drones can be a daunting task, especially with the evolving price dynamics. The price of camera drones is influenced by several factors, including technological advancements, brand reputation, and consumer demand. As drone technology continues to advance, the cost for high-end models has seen fluctuations, often reflecting enhancements in camera quality, flight durability, and feature sets. Understanding these aspects is crucial for potential buyers seeking value for their investment.
Firstly, camera quality is a major determinant of a camera drone’s price. Drones equipped with superior cameras capable of capturing HD or even 4K video are generally priced higher. These high-resolution cameras are particularly favored by professional photographers and videographers who require top-notch image quality. Secondly, features like GPS navigation, obstacle avoidance systems, and autonomous flight modes also contribute to the overall cost.

The Cost Spectrum
When examining the price of camera drones, the spectrum ranges from budget-friendly models priced under $100 to professional drones that can exceed $1,500. Entry-level drones offer basic functionality and are ideal for beginners exploring aerial photography. Mid-range drones, typically between $300-$600, provide a balanced mix of quality and features, appealing to hobbyists who seek a more enhanced flying experience. High-end drones, meanwhile, are targeted at professionals requiring sophisticated equipment for commercial purposes.
Technological Advancements
Technological advancements have caused a notable shift in the price of camera drones. Features like increased battery life, enhanced stability, and intelligent flight modes make these devices more valuable, yet possibly more expensive. As innovation continues, consumers might expect prices to rise due to added functionalities that enhance their flying experience.
FAQs
- Are cheaper camera drones worth it?
- It depends on your needs. While cheaper drones may lack some advanced features, they can be a great entry point for beginners.
- How often do camera drone prices change?
- The prices can change frequently due to technological updates and market competition. It’s good to keep an eye on current trends and offers.
- What future trends might affect drone pricing?
- Improvements in battery technology, autonomous functionality, and increased competition are likely to impact future pricing, potentially decreasing costs for entry-level models.
